Key Responsibilities

  • •Launch and lead a world-class EHS program at the new biomanufacturing facility, building a safety culture focused on behaviors, leadership, open reporting, accountability, and helping others.
  • •Oversee biosafety, chemical safety, and physical safety programs for cell and gene therapy operations, including containment, decontamination, and regulated waste disposal.
  • •Conduct Job Hazard Analyses (JHA) and risk evaluations for novel advanced therapies, and manage EHS compliance for occupational/process safety, permitting, exposure protection, OSHA reporting, and waste management.
  • •Provide EHS input into laboratory and manufacturing suite design and equipment/function.
  • •Lead root-cause incident investigations, recommend corrective and preventive actions, and drive development/implementation of EHS programs, inspections, and training targeting ISO45001 and ISO14001 certification.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s or master’s degree in environmental science, Occupational Safety, Industrial Hygiene, or a related scientific field.
  • •8+ years of experience establishing new facilities for GMP manufacturing biologics or cell and gene therapies.
  • •Preferred biosafety and safety credentials: RBP or CBSP, CSP, or CIH.
  • •Ability to work independently and use sound judgment and professional maturity.
  • •Ability to work onsite in Pittsburgh, PA.
